Output 66cb4105f2383f2052f6b8c22e60ea3a9473669f864acec835217ea774a4f2e5:5

value
195972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c79e62a7153dbfae388a28f840618782e4d93b OP_EQUAL
address
33x3Gu1pwFmDxNXxdv4RKCpnagiDTYy9GS
transaction
66cb4105f2383f2052f6b8c22e60ea3a9473669f864acec835217ea774a4f2e5
spent
true